"We really enjoyed our stay in the historic center of Tivoli with Regina B&B. Filipo was a great host and took good care of us. The accommodations are rustic but updated nicely. We particularly enjoyed the rooftop overlooking the square. It's nicely decorated and has a nice sun shield to mitigate the bright sun and offer shade. We enjoyed our morning tea and early evening wine up there listening to the sounds in the square below.
The breakfasts were very tasty and served with cheer.There are only 3 rooms so it was nice to meet the other guests and enjoy the homey feel of the place.
You should know that there is no nearby parking. You can pull up and drop off your bags, but you have to be rung into the main hall by Filipo (so coordinate by WhatsApp with him a specific time to arrive to be sure he can meet you). The rooms are 2 stories up by fairly narrow stairs.
There are plenty of restaurants all over Tivoli, and the street right in front of the B&B leads down to several different price ranges. Our favorite was Sebilla. You need to make reservations in advance, but well worth the view and the very reasonable price for the views and quality food."

What’s there to see and do in Castel di Tora?
Explore the area and family-friendly sights such as Terme di Cretone, or get out into nature at a spot like Lago del Turano. In the wider area, you’ll find Lago del Salto and Borgo San Pietro.
